阿里云 PolarDB 通过自研超低延迟文件系统 PolarFS 和全新共识协议 ParallelRaft 实现技术突破,支持 MySQL、PostgreSQL 和 Oracle 等传统数据库一键迁移上云,最快数小时内完成。采用存储计算分离架构,云上成本不到传统数据库的 1/6,TCO 低于自建数据库 50%。提供评估工具和一键迁移工具,保障平滑接入,兼具高弹性与高性能,满足海量数据存储需求。
阿里云 PolarDB 发布重大更新 支持 Oracle 等数据库一键迁移上云
5 月 21 日,阿里云 PolarDB 发布重大更新,提供传统数据库一键迁移上云能力,可以帮助企业将线下的 MySQL、PostgreSQL 和 Oracle 等数据库轻松上云,最快数小时内迁移完成。据估算,云上成本不到传统数据库的 1/6。目前,已有约 40 万个数据库迁移到阿里云上。阿里云方面表示,该产品实现了两大技术突破:通过自研超低延迟文件系统 PolarFS 大幅降低数据跨网络的延迟,并且开发了一种全新的共识协议 ParallelRaft,提升系统吞吐量。在此之前,PolarFS 的研究成果已发表在数据库顶级会议 VLDB 2018《PolarFS: An Ultra-low Latency and Failure Resilient Distributed File System for Shared Storage Cloud Database》。企业在使用传统商业数据库时,经常会面临授权费用贵、硬件成本高、架构与运维复杂、迁移难度大等问题,此次云原生数据库 PolarDB 的重大更新针对此类痛点,实现一键快速迁移,并提供云上的完整生态服务。
阿里云 PolarDB 实现传统数据库一键迁移上云
本报讯近日,阿里云数据库 PolarDB 发布重大更新,提供传统数据库一键迁移上云能力,可以帮助企业将线下的 MySQL、PostgreSQL 和 Oracle 等数据库轻松上云,最快数小时内迁移完成。据估算,云上成本不到传统数据库的 1/6。目前,已有约 40 万个数据库迁移到阿里云上。阿里云方面表示,该产品实现了两大技术突破:通过自研超低延迟文件系统 PolarFS 大幅降低数据跨网络的延迟,并且开发了一种全新的共识协议 ParallelRaft,提升系统吞吐量。据悉,此前 PolarFS 的研究成果已发表于数据库顶级会议 VLDB 2018。PolarDB 是阿里云在 2018 年正式商业化的云原生数据库,采用存储计算分离、软硬件一体化设计,具备自感知、自决策、自恢复、自优化四大能力。阿里云智能数据库事业部负责人李飞飞表示,云原生数据库在成本、灵活度、安全、技术进化层面都优于传统数据库,传统数据库会像马车一样被淘汰。
云原生数据库 PolarDB
云原生数据库 PolarDB,完全兼容 MySQL 和 PostgreSQL,高度兼容 Oracle 语法,支持集中式和分布式,支持千亿级大表和 PB 级存储,满足海量数据、超高并发的业务场景需求。相比自建数据库,PolarDB 以 50% 的 TCO 成本提供最高 6 倍于开源数据库的交易性能和 400 倍的分析性能。PolarDB 支持单 AZ、双 AZ、三 AZ、跨 Region 多级高可用配置,最高具备 99.995% 的可用性;支持快速弹性和线性扩展,通过 Serverless 提供纵向和横向大范围资源弹性伸缩能力,提供读写线性扩展;支持 HTAP,一份数据既可进行事务处理又能实时分析。目前,PolarDB 已广泛服务于互联网、金融、政务、运营商、零售、汽车、交通物流等行业。云原生数据库 PolarDB 提供数据库生态兼容、海量存储、高性价比和高可用性,支持快速扩展与无缝迁移,助您有效降低成本。生态兼容,无缝衔接现有系统 1 100% 兼容 MySQL 和 PostgreSQL 生态,一键迁移工具保障 MySQL/PostgreSQL 轻松迁移至 PolarDB;高度兼容 Oracle 语法,评估工具全链路助力 Oracle 迁移;无论是集中式部署还是分布式架构,都能轻松融入现有系统,助力企业数据库战略无缝升级。
从 RDS 迁移至 PolarDB-X 1.0
本文将介绍如何通过 PolarDB-X 1.0 的评估导入功能将数据从 RDS 迁移至 PolarDB-X 1.0。问题 业务增长带来的数据量膨胀以及存储、并发、QPS 的增长,都会导致 RDS 性能瓶颈的出现。此时迁移到 PolarDB-X 1.0 进行分库分表是一个很好的选择。但将数据从 RDS 迁移至 PolarDB-X 1.0,您可能需要考虑如下问题:PolarDB-X 1.0 实例规格如何选取?PolarDB-X 1.0 下挂载的私有定制 RDS 规格如何选取?RDS 中的单表迁移到 PolarDB-X 1.0 后,如何拆分?如何选取分表数及拆分键?如何快速建库、建表?如何快速将数据从 RDS 导入到 PolarDB-X 1.0?解决方案 PolarDB-X 1.0 针对上述问题,提供了评估导入功能,帮助您轻松快速地从 RDS 迁移至 PolarDB-X 1.0。表 1.迁移流程 步骤 说明 步骤一:获取评估建议 PolarDB-X 1.0 的评估建议功能够:推荐迁移后的 PolarDB-X 1.0 实例规格以及 PolarDB-X 1.0 数据库下挂载的私有定制 RDS 实例规格。为源 RDS 的每一张表提供拆分方案,包括源库中各个表是否拆分、选取哪个字段为拆分键、源库中各个表导入到 PolarDB-X 1.0 时的建表语句等。步骤二:数据导入 PolarDB-X 1.0 的数据导入功能支持:通过评估建议开始导入:基于评估建议的结果,提供快速建库、建表、数据导入的一体化迁移方案。
FAQ
PolarDB 迁移支持哪些数据库?
支持 MySQL、PostgreSQL 和 Oracle 等数据库。
迁移成本如何?
云上成本不到传统数据库的 1/6,TCO 低于自建数据库 50%。
迁移需要多久?
最快数小时内迁移完成。